01 How it works

Four steps from phones to a finished cut.

Keep scrolling — the steps move sideways

01/ 04

Open a URL.

Devices join from any phone or laptop browser. No App Store, no IPA, no APK — just a link on the LAN.

  • No install
  • iOS · Android · laptop
  • Camera · screen · mic
02/ 04

Arm & frame.

Every assigned camera streams live to your laptop over the LAN. Frame each angle in the grid before you commit to record.

  • Live LAN preview
  • Per-camera bitrate
  • Pre-flight checks
03/ 04

Record losslessly.

Every angle records copy-only — no re-encoding. Near-zero CPU on the laptop; the phones do the work.

  • Copy-only
  • Near-zero CPU
  • Per-angle masters
04/ 04

Cut in post.

Press 1–9 to mark the program take while you record. Export the edit as one MP4, or keep the per-angle masters.

  • Press 1–9 to take
  • switches.json log
  • Export one MP4
